Recession: Engage in SMEs, Nigerians urged

Date: 2017-01-06

Nigerians have been tasked to embrace Small and Medium scales Enterprises (SMEs) to ameliorate effect of the economic recession in the country.

A Pastor of Christ Apostolic Church, Osere area of Ilorin, Kwara State, Pastor Samuel Sunday Ojo, made the disclosure in a sermon to commemorate New Year celebration.

He said "the recession is a wake up call to Nigerians to start something because an idle hand is the devil's workshop. See the many problems in Nigeria as opportunities.

"See yourself as an entrepreneur with innovations to solve societal problems and in return the society will reward you financially." He noted that there are many challenges which could pose threat but insisted that they should not be deterred.

"There will always be a solution if you are determined as an entrepreneur to really create value and solve problems," he added. The pastor advised Christians to unite and live in harmony with Muslims and people of other religions to move the country forward.

He said, "people should not lose hope in this because whenever there is going to be a transition there will be a lot of challenges.
